Schematic illustration of a parasternal short-axis echocardiographic view showing ventricular septal defects
This schematic of the parasternal short-axis echocardiographic view shows the location of the membranous septum (MS; blue) with membranous defect (M), the infundibular septum (IS; yellow) with infundibular defect (I), and atrioventricular septum (AVS; pink).
R: right coronary cusp of the aortic valve; N: noncoronary cusp; L: left coronary cusp; LA: left atrium; RA: right atrium; TV: tricuspid valve; RV: right ventricle; MPA: main pulmonary artery.
